Street parking by Rue Saint Léonard: meters, time limits, and permits
On-street parking around central Liège is typically managed with paid meters and signed time limits. You may also see areas reserved for residents/permits or specific vehicle types—so always follow the exact wording on the signs before you park.
If you’re staying longer than the posted limit (or you’re arriving during busy periods), street parking can turn into a last-minute scramble; in that case, booking a private spot on Mobypark is a straightforward way to avoid time pressure and availability risk.
How to pay: in Liège you can usually pay at a meter or via a mobile method associated with the street system—so check the instructions on the machine/zone you use.
Garages and public car parks: compare daily pricing and access
Garages and public car parks near the city centre are convenient when you want predictable access, but prices can vary a lot. Public listings for nearby areas show examples like ~€14.5/day for some routes and up to ~€22.31/day for certain locations (while some areas can be lower, depending on the exact car park and level).
